Harley Hudson reflects on her TNA debut.
On the May 23rd edition of TNA Xplosion, the promotion would see two debuts for knockouts, as Harley Hudson would meet Myla Grace in singles action, with the pair wrestling to a ten minute time limit draw. The pair have struck up a partnership since, wrestling as a team together on several occasions.
While speaking to WhatCulture in a new interview, Harley Hudson was asked if Myla was the 'perfect fit' as an opponent for her TNA debut on Xplosion.
"Definitely. I think it really helps me to wrestle somebody that I knew, knew all the new sorts of tricks and all that, which was good. But also to, you know, we were sort of coming in from a similar situation. Obviously, she'd been in Japan and was doing her thing, I was in Butlands and all that, both equally as a graft as obviously the two opposite ends of the spectrum but equally we've both sort of grafted it out since the Gut Check and all that so getting to come in together and share that experience together was really really nice and I also wouldn't change that for the world, do you know what I mean? I think that's something that we'll share no matter what, where her career takes it or mine, vice versa, we'll always like share that and have that little bond that way so yeah."
